QatarEnergy is an integrated national oil corporation that stands at theforefront of efforts for the long term sustainable
development,utilization and monetization of oil and gas resources in the State ofQatar.In its efforts to become one of the
best national energy companies inthe world, QatarEnergy's activities and those of its subsidiaries andjoint ventures,
encompass the entire spectrum of the oil and gas valuechain locally, regionally, and internationally.They include the
exploration, refining and production, marketing, andsale of oil and gas, liquefied natural gas (LNG), natural gas
liquids(NGL), gas to liquids (GTL) products, refined products, petrochemicals,fertilizers, steel and aluminum. As an
integrated corporation,QatarEnergy's activities also include marketing and sale of oil and gasand other various
products.QatarEnergy's operations and activities are conducted at various onshorelocations, including Doha, Dukhan and
the Mesaieed and Ras LaffanIndustrial Cities; and at various offshore areas, such as offshore oilfields production stations,
drilling platforms, Halul oil export island,and the North Field, which is the largest single non-associated gasreservoir in the
world covering an area of 6,000 square kilometers. Theutilization of this field’s massive reserves has become a
primarynational goal to continue the development and prosperity of the country.QatarEnergy pays the utmost attention to
the health and safety of itsemployees, contractors, visitors and the local communities where itoperates. From drilling to
construction, operations to decommissioning,QatarEnergy's health, safety and environment policy forms an integralpart of
the corporation’s daily business and long term planning.QatarEnergy is committed to contribute to a better future by
meetingtoday’s economic needs, while safeguarding our environment and resourcesfor generations to come. Thriving on
innovation and excellence,QatarEnergy is bound to the highest levels of sustainable human, socio-economic, and
environmental development in Qatar and beyond.

mselect is looking to hire a Senior Construction Supervisor for a oil and gas operator in Doha, Qatar . Candidates must have a minimum of eight to ten (10 to 12) years of experience in relevant construction and installation activities in projects of the oil & gas industry. Fluency in English is a must.
Key Responsibilities
- Monitor, control, and report Contractor’s performance, man-power deployment, plant and equipment movements, construction slippages, etc
- Conduct daily and weekly meetings with Contractors involving all discipline supervisors, QA/QC Inspectors, and HSE advisors and address/resolve issues hindering progress
- Act as the construction Risk Management representative to identify Construction Risk events, the effects & consequences, propose mitigation measures and take ownership to ensure mitigation measures have been implemented at the site
- Review and forward to management daily and weekly construction progress reports for assigned projects and verify contractor's progress statements for accuracy.
- Liaise with senior discipline engineers throughout all phases of the project for all construction related matters including inputs during the detailed engineering and procurement stages.
- Participate in reviewing detailed design drawings, method statements, material requisitions, material receipt inspection, etc
- Review contractors’ construction plans, schedules, method statements, and procedures including offshore logistics.
- Supervise and approve construction activities and co-ordinate various aspects of project construction including material, work, and testing inspections in the fabrication yard, material submissions, and working drawings from contractor and processing documentation as required.
- Check and ensure that all construction works are completed in accordance with approved standards and consistent with contract specifications.
- Coordinate the MCC walk-through, pre-commissioning, and commissioning activities with contractors, vendors, and end-users
- Maintain a daily record of progress noting special comments. Reports to supervisor work anomalies or contractual deviations committed by contractor personnel and recommends corrective actions.
- Monitor and control work permits to ensure that contractor compliance with conditions fixed on consolidated work permits.
- Coordinate mobilization and demobilization of contractors, sub-contractors, and vendors to offshore sites following the contract award.
- Interact and interface with other contractors, projects, and departments regularly to identify and resolve all construction-related matters especially liaison with Production and Maintenance departments.

To co-ordinate and supervise the activities of the foremen and his crew on the project. Must ensure compliance with HSE, Quality and Ethics policy and attached roles and responsibilities. Liaise With:Construction superintendent, Other discipline Supervisor on the project. Production engineers, All other support services Supervisors in the yard.
**Key Tasks and Responsibilities**:
- To be capable of communicating fluently with Crew, Foremen, Superintendent and all others whom with whom he liaises.
- Be capable of reading and understanding drawings, dimensional survey, project specifications and procedures and be capable of taking the correct remedial actions. (Wherever Applicable)
- To be conversant with the specific standards applicable to the project / area of work.
- To be capable of looking four weeks ahead in planning of work for the project utilize the project current plan for planning for future work.
- Provide his Foremen with drawings and information require to do the work efficiently, productively and safely.
- Interface with the production engineer / field engineers to ensure material is available for the planned work.
- To ensure Proper tools and equipment’s are available and they are utilized efficiently, productively and safely.
- To utilize the overall project / area plan(s), milestone dates, yard layouts and construction drawings to understand the overall view of the project and or his area of responsibility.
- Have an overall view and understanding of the project completion including but not limited to construction methodology, fab sequence and milestone dates.
- Forecast resources required for the planned work ahead (Manpower, Equipment’s etc.)
- To be able to conduct meeting with those reporting to him in an organized manner.
- To set targets of production for each of those directly reporting to him, targets for Foremen.
- To be able to communicate supports services in the yard, plate shop, pipe shop, rigging, scaffolding, warehouse, facility, QC & NDT.
- Provide written instruction where necessary to those directly reporting to him.
- Drive the team to achieve progress, productivity, safety and quality.
Know and understand the estimated man-hours on the work packs, maintain man-hours booking within estimate and provide weekly progress to production engineers.
- Take actions where standards and targets are not met.
- Where necessary refer quality / progress/ productivity issue to his superintendent and provide recommendation for improvement
- Address any issue of poor quality/ productivity and take action where appropriate.
- Report area of poor performance and provide recommendation for improvement.
- Provide accurate feedback to Superintendent.
- Ensure CIR (Computer Input Request) submitted and RFI (Request for Inspection) are raised on timely manner.
- Conduct TBT with crew, conduct safety walkthrough and address any issue of safety, check HIT process.
- Review TRA with his foremen when require and ensure it is discussed with his crew.
- Maintain good housekeeping on his work area. Promote BBSM process be responsible for his team’s safety.
- Lead by example and make sure company policies and procedures are followed.
